WineDo 5 - NYC Sunday June 3, 2012 post BRT

5th annual WineDo. There's room for 4 additional people.

Sunday June 3, 2012 at 7:00 (1900).

Cost will be about $82.

Place: North Square

Address: TBD

Here's the link to WineDo4 ... http://www.flyertalk.com/forum/commu...-post-brt.html
The menu can be read at post 154.



Some notes from WineDo 3. Take a look/see so you can get in the mood. WineDo 3 - Sunday June 13, 2010 New York City - Greenwich Village

While the linked thread may look to some that we're bragging about what we own , the WineDo is open to everyone. The only qualification is that you have to bring a bottle of (drinkable) wine. Estimated cost of dinner is $80, which includes tax and tip. The majority of wine last year ranged anywhere from $25 - $200 bottle. Everyone stepped up. This dinner is a great way to taste and discuss wine, in addition to miles, points, and etc.

24 Flyertalkers attended last year... and we had 38 bottles.

For WineDo 5, You're expected to bring a wine that cost a minimum of $35, and a maximum of whatever you like. This is our first price increase. If you'd like to bring something experimental, it will have to be in addition to the minimum cost wine. After some previous discussion, this seemed to be the best solution. Also, several people talked about stepping up. That's fine. But rather than sit all the fancy wine people together , dinner will still sort of be open seating.

We drank some great juice last year. I don't know how we can possibly top it. Flyertalkers never disappoint. If you're not a drinker, you're still invited. They sell beer and other beverages.

Our distinguised wine panel mjm and cordelli, will coordinate what's drinkable. Last year we enjoyed multiple bottles of red and white wine. We could use a nice champagne to start.
